Arduino Eğitimleri

Arduino ile Çizgi İzleyen Yapımı

Arduino, Processing/Wiring dilini kullanarak çevre elemanları ile temel giriş çıkış uygulamalarını gerçekleştiren açık kaynaklı fiziksel programlama platformudur. Arduino ile bağımsız olarak interaktif uygulamalar gerçekleştirilebilirsiniz. Aynı zamanda Arduinoyu bilgisayar ile Flash, Processing, MaxMSP, C Sharp gibi bir çok yazılım üzerinden yada kendi yazdığınız yazılımlarla haberleştirerek de kullanabilirsiniz. Açık kaynaklı arayüz yazılımını internet sitesinden Windows, Mac OS X ve Linux platformları için indirebilirsiniz.

Arduino UNO R3, Arduino Uno’un en son çıkan modelidir. Bundan önceki modellerde (Uno, Duemilanove) bulunan tüm özellikleri desteklemektedir. UNO R3 modeliyle birlikte önceki versiyonlardaki 8U2 modeli yerine 16U2 modeli kullanılmıştır. Bu şekilde daha hızlı veri aktarımı daha az hafıza kullanılarak gerçekleştirilmiştir. Linux ve Mac bilgisayarlarda Arduino’yu bilgisayara bağlamak için herhangi bir driver’a ihtiyaç yoktur. Windows bilgisayarlarda Arduino IDE yazılımı içinde gelen inf dosyasını bilgisayarınıza tanıtmanız yeterlidir. Bu şekilde Arduino’nuzu bilgisayarınıza klavye, mouse, joystik ve benzeri aksesuarlar gibi takıp kullanılabilir hale getirebilirsiniz.

UNO R3 ekstradan SDA ve SCL pinlerine sahiptir bu pinler kart yerleşiminde AREF pininin yanında bulunmaktadır. Bununla birlikte kart üzerinde önceki versiyonlardan farklı olarak reset pininin yanına iki yeni pin eklenmiştir. Biri shieldlere kart üzerinden besleme sağlamak amacıyla IOREF pini diğeri ise ileride kullanılmak üzere ayrılmış boş bağlantısız pindir. UNO R3 piyasada bulunan tüm shieldler ile uyumlu olup yeni pinleri ile de bundan sonra üretilecek olan yeni shieldlere de uyumlu haldedir.